A 16-year-old girl was badly injured in a hit and run crash in Derry-Londonderry yesterday afternoon.
The teenager, who had got off a school bus, was hit by a dark silver car on the Racecourse Road near Ballyarnett Village at 4pm.
She suffered a broken leg and fractured pelvis. Police say that she could have been killed in the incident.
The driver of the car sped off after the collision.
Police have asked for the public’s help in tracking down the car and the driver.
They have asked that any motorist in the vicinity at the time of the crash with dash cam footage or who witnessed anything to contact them on 101.
